<b>Description: DbMpoolFile::set_lsn_offset</b>
<p>The DbMpoolFile::set_lsn_offset method specifies the zero-based byte offset
of a log sequence number (<a href="../api_cxx/lsn_class.html">DbLsn</a>) on the file's pages, for the
purposes of page-flushing as part of transaction checkpoint. (See the
<a href="../api_cxx/memp_sync.html">DbEnv::memp_sync</a> documentation for more information.)</p>
<p>The DbMpoolFile::set_lsn_offset method configures a file in the memory pool, not only
operations performed using the specified <a href="../api_cxx/mempfile_class.html">DbMpoolFile</a> handle.</p>
<p>The DbMpoolFile::set_lsn_offset method may not be called after the <a href="../api_cxx/memp_fopen.html">DbMpoolFile::open</a> method is
called.
If the file is already open in the memory pool when
<a href="../api_cxx/memp_fopen.html">DbMpoolFile::open</a> is called, the information specified to DbMpoolFile::set_lsn_offset
must be consistent with the existing file or an error will be
returned.
</p>
<p>The DbMpoolFile::set_lsn_offset method
either returns a non-zero error value
or throws an exception that encapsulates a non-zero error value on
failure, and returns 0 on success.
</p>
<b>Parameters</b> <br>
<b>lsn_offset</b><ul compact><li>The <b>lsn_offset</b> parameter is the zero-based byte offset of the
log sequence number on the file's pages.</ul>

<b>Description: DbMpoolFile::get_lsn_offset</b>
<p>The DbMpoolFile::get_lsn_offset method returns the log sequence number byte offset.</p>
<p>The DbMpoolFile::get_lsn_offset method may be called at any time during the life of the
application.</p>
<p>The DbMpoolFile::get_lsn_offset method
either returns a non-zero error value
or throws an exception that encapsulates a non-zero error value on
failure, and returns 0 on success.
</p>
<b>Parameters</b> <br>
<b>lsn_offsetp</b><ul compact><li>The DbMpoolFile::get_lsn_offset method returns the
log sequence number byte offset in <b>lsn_offsetp</b>.</ul>
